Throughout 26 years of nonstop activity and chessed, Rabbi Binyamin Fisher, founder and director of Magen La’Choleh, has revolutionized the concept of medical referrals and counseling. Magen La’Choleh was founded at the urging of Rabbi Fisher’s spiritual mentor Hagaon Harav Shlomo Zalman Auerbach, zt”l, and was the very first organization to offer direct assistance and support to patients and their families in and out of the hospital; personal accompaniment and guidance from the moment of diagnosis and until recovery; unbiased medical referrals; and no less important, emotional support and encouragement.

Four hundred and fifty calls flood the office on a daily basis, all with urgent requests to speak to Rabbi Fisher and consult with him on a wide range of medical issues. Rabbi Fisher meets weekly with some 90 doctors and is regular contact with dozens of hospitals in Israel and around the world.

Magen La’Choleh encompasses special departments for oncology patients and mental health patients, and arranges free medical equipment and medical transport for patients and preemies, among others.
